Why This Tour Stands Out

Private Tour to Golden Bridge Ba Na Hills in Da Nang Vietnam - Why This Tour Stands Out

The highlight of this experience is unquestionably the Golden Bridge—an engineering marvel that looks like a silk ribbon floating among clouds, supported by two giant stone hands. This is a must-see for any visitor to Da Nang, offering perfect photo ops and a sense of wonder. Past visitors note that standing on the bridge feels surreal, especially with the panoramic views of the lush mountains around.

Beyond the bridge, the scenic ride on cable cars deserves special mention. These cable cars hold four world records, including the longest unpatched wire and the largest one-wire sling. The ride itself is a visual feast—imagine floating above green forests and misty peaks—adding an extra layer of awe to your visit.

The diversity of attractions at Ba Na Hills keeps the experience engaging. From the tranquil Linh Ung Pagoda, home to a towering Buddha figure, to the evocative French Village with its old villas, each spot tells a story. The Sun World Ba Na Hills complex also features the Fantasy Park, a large amusement area perfect for kids and adults alike.

Detailed Itinerary Breakdown

Private Tour to Golden Bridge Ba Na Hills in Da Nang Vietnam - Detailed Itinerary Breakdown

Stop 1: Golden Bridge

Starting early at 8:00 am, the tour takes you straight into the heart of the Ba Na Hills. The highlight here is the Golden Hand Bridge, which opens around 9:30 am. This bridge is more than just a pretty photo spot—it’s an architectural icon, perched 1,400 meters high, giving you views that stretch out over the mountains and valleys below.

Travelers mention the cable cars that take you up to this altitude. Not only do they offer breathtaking views, but they also set four world records, including the longest distance between stations. One reviewer, Viet, noted how the cable car ride “set four world records,” making the journey as memorable as the destination. The smooth ride provides ample opportunities to snap photos of the lush landscape and misty peaks, so be sure your camera is charged.

Stop 2: Sun World Ba Na Hills

Once at the top, you’ll have time to explore the complex. Highlights include the Le Jardin D’Amour (Flower Garden of Love), a beautifully landscaped area perfect for wandering and capturing colorful photos. The Linh Ung Pagoda offers a peaceful retreat with its impressive 27-meter Buddha statue perched on a lotus, giving a moment of serenity amid the scenic chaos.

You’ll also get to see the Vestige of French Old Villas—a charming glimpse into the colonial past of the area. Past visitors appreciated learning about the history behind these structures, which adds depth to the visit.

Next, another cable car whisks you to Nui Chua Peak, where Fantasy Park and the old French Village await. The park is packed with rides and entertainment, making it a hit with families or anyone seeking some fun.
